Riding the AI Wave: Decoding Dan Ives‘ New ETF and the Future of Artificial Intelligence Investments

The world of investing is constantly evolving, and right now, the spotlight is firmly fixed on artificial intelligence. Wedbush tech analyst Dan Ives, a prominent voice in the tech sector, has launched the “IVES” ETF, aiming to capture the growth potential in this rapidly expanding market. But what does this mean for you, the investor? Let’s dive in.

Unpacking the IVES ETF: What’s Under the Hood?

The Dan Ives Wedbush AI Revolution ETF (ticker: IVES) is designed to track an index based on Wedbush’s “AI 30” research list. This index is dynamic, meaning the holdings will shift as the AI landscape evolves. Expect to see established giants like Nvidia, Microsoft, Alphabet (Google), Amazon, and Tesla. But the fund also aims to include promising smaller players, such as SoundHound AI and CyberArk Software. This blend gives investors exposure to both established leaders and emerging innovators.

Did you know? The index will be reconfigured quarterly, and adjustments can be made more frequently to account for corporate actions. This agility is crucial in a field that’s changing at breakneck speed.

Beyond the Buzzwords: The AI Revolution is Expanding

Dan Ives believes the AI revolution is moving beyond semiconductors (like Nvidia) and into software, infrastructure, consumer applications, and derivatives. This suggests that IVES will target a broader range of AI-related companies, covering various sectors. This diversification could potentially lead to more sustainable growth as the industry matures.

Competitive Landscape: How Does IVES Stack Up?

The ETF market is competitive. The Global X Artificial Intelligence & Technology ETF (AIQ) is a key competitor, managing over $3 billion in assets. While AIQ has shown impressive gains, IVES offers a unique perspective rooted in Wedbush’s specific research. The management fee for IVES is 0.75%, a bit higher than some popular thematic ETFs but competitive with active equity funds.

Nvidia Navigating the AI Chip Crossroads: China, Regulations, and Future Growth

The AI chip market is booming, and Nvidia (NVDA) is at the forefront. But a significant headwind has emerged: China. Recent U.S. restrictions on chip exports are reshaping Nvidia’s strategy and impacting its future outlook. This article delves into the challenges, opportunities, and potential trends shaping the future of this critical industry.

The China Challenge: Export Bans and Market Share Shifts

The U.S. government is concerned about the use of powerful AI chips in China, particularly for military applications. This has led to stringent export controls, requiring licenses for advanced chips like Nvidia’s H20, a version tailored for the Chinese market. These restrictions are creating a significant disruption.

Nvidia’s market share in China has plummeted from 95% to approximately 50%, according to CEO Jensen Huang. The impact is considerable, as China was a key growth driver. Nvidia recorded $17.1 billion in annual sales to customers in China (including Hong Kong) – its fourth-largest market. This, coupled with a $5.5 billion writedown on inventory, underscores the financial impact of these changes. Analysts are anticipating a revenue hit and a significant deceleration of growth.

Kraken’s Leap: Tokenized Securities and the Future of Crypto Exchanges

Crypto exchange Kraken is making a significant move, planning to offer tokenized securities to customers outside the United States. This signals a potential shift in how traditional assets are traded and accessed. But what exactly does this mean, and what are the implications for the future of digital assets and trading?

Tokenized Securities: Bridging the Gap Between Crypto and Traditional Markets

Kraken’s initiative focuses on “xStocks,” allowing users to trade tokenized versions of shares like Apple, Tesla, and Nvidia, among others. These tokens will be available 24/7, mirroring the always-on nature of cryptocurrency trading. This contrasts with traditional stock markets, which operate within set hours.

The exchange is partnering with Backed, a firm specializing in blockchain-based financial assets, to bring over 50 U.S. stocks and ETFs to the Solana blockchain. This collaboration highlights the growing trend of integrating traditional finance with blockchain technology.

Did you know? Tokenization involves representing ownership of an asset on a blockchain. This process enhances liquidity, enables fractional ownership, and can potentially reduce transaction costs.

Why Tokenization Matters: Democratizing Access and Boosting Liquidity

Tokenization has the potential to democratize access to financial markets. By enabling fractional ownership, individuals with limited capital can invest in assets that were previously out of reach. This could broaden the investor base and boost market participation.

Furthermore, tokenized assets can increase liquidity. Blockchain technology facilitates faster and more efficient trading, potentially leading to narrower bid-ask spreads and improved market efficiency. The ability to trade 24/7 is a key advantage.

The Competitive Landscape: Kraken vs. the Established Players

Kraken, which launched in the U.S. before Coinbase, is positioning itself at the forefront of this new market. However, Kraken is not alone in exploring this space. Binance, for example, made a short-lived attempt to tokenize equities in 2021 before regulators pushed back.

The success of Kraken’s venture could hinge on several factors, including regulatory clarity, user adoption, and the ability to integrate seamlessly with existing trading platforms.

Real-life example: Companies like Robinhood and BlackRock are actively exploring asset tokenization, signaling mainstream interest in this emerging trend.

Challenges and Risks: Navigating the Regulatory Minefield

The primary challenge facing Kraken and other companies in this space is regulatory uncertainty. The U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) has taken a cautious approach to crypto assets, and tokenized securities fall under similar scrutiny.

Regulatory compliance is crucial, and companies must carefully navigate the legal landscape to avoid penalties and ensure the security of user funds. The SEC has previously charged Kraken $30 million for failing to register certain offerings. Source: SEC
